Linux相關

  1. 串口工具

    minicom   

    http://www.2cto.com/os/201111/110568.html

 Ctrl+a 然後 z, 進入配置界面,  o 進入serial port 配置, l 進入log輸出配置(暫不生效)

x 或 q 退出

root@ubuntu-desktop:/home/ubuntu# dmesg | grep tty
[    0.000000] console [tty0] enabled
[    1.441487] 00:06: ttyS0 at I/O 0x3f8 (irq = 4, base_baud = 115200) is a 16550A
[    1.462174] 00:07: ttyS1 at I/O 0x2f8 (irq = 3, base_baud = 115200) is a 16550A
[    1.482850] 00:08: ttyS2 at I/O 0x3e8 (irq = 7, base_baud = 115200) is a 16550A
[    1.503593] 00:09: ttyS3 at I/O 0x2e8 (irq = 7, base_baud = 115200) is a 16550A
[    1.524292] 00:0a: ttyS4 at I/O 0x2f0 (irq = 7, base_baud = 115200) is a 16550A
[    1.544980] 00:0b: ttyS5 at I/O 0x2e0 (irq = 7, base_baud = 115200) is a 16550A
[    2.612211] systemd[1]: Created slice system-getty.slice.

!!! minicom -s 解決無顯示問題

2.串口查看

ls -l /dev/ttyUSB*     ls -l /dev/ttySdmesg  | grep ttyS*

3.遠程 ssh

sudo apt-get install openssh-server

root@ubuntu-desktop:/home/ubuntu# sudo ps -e |grep ssh   #查詢ssh服務
13476 ?        00:00:00 sshd

sudo service ssh start

遠程 SecureCRT    ssh2   連接  hostname = IP     登錄

4.遠程桌面 

http://www.cnblogs.com/lanxuezaipiao/p/3724958.html

vnc-viewer

sudo apt-get install vnc4server
用戶模式
~$ vncserver
啓動vnc,產生.vnc 目錄

#修改原有xstartup文件以圖形化訪問

5.解決只有guest登錄

然後執行: vi /etc/lightdm/lightdm.conf.
增加 greeter-show-manual-login=true allow-guest=false . 修改完的整個配置文件是
[SeatDefaults]
greeter-session=unity-greeter
user-session=ubuntu
greeter-show-manual-login=true #手工輸入登陸系統的用戶名和密碼
allow-guest=false #不允許guest登錄 .

6.完全卸載xubuntu-desktop

sudo apt-get remove xfce4

sudo apt-get remove xfcer*

sudo apt-get autoremove 

sudo apt-get clean

7.samba 文件共享

1)vi /etc/samba/smb.conf  
#配置一個公開的訪問目錄,在新創建的smb.conf文件中加入以下配置  
<pre name="code" class="plain">
#========= Global Settings ========  
[global]  
workgroup = WORKGROUP  
map to guest = bad user  
#===== Share Definitions ==========
[MyShare]  
#共享目錄路徑
path = /home/samba/share  
browsable =yes  
writable = yes  
guest ok = yes  
read only = no

2)設置文件夾權限,檢測配置文件

chmod -R 0777 /home/samba/share  
testparm

3)重啓Samba服務即可解決 、etc/init.d/samba restart

!!!解決只能看到文件夾,無法進入的問題:

smbpasswd -a usr(usr用自己的用戶名即可,密碼就不一定和系統密碼相同),
然後輸入兩次密碼
注意必須先用su 進入root模式,smbpasswd -a -usr 命令纔有效,否則無法添加新用戶
這點是必須做的,因爲將來你登陸vm的時候,windows會詢問你的密碼和用戶名,沒有建立是進不去的

8.查詢網卡狀態

mii-tool    mii-tool -v    mii-tool -w

 ifconfig -a       ethtool eth0

9. sudo apt install eclipse

配置pydev

10.linux 系統備份

tar cvpzf /media/backup.tgz --exclude=/proc --exclude=/lost+found --exclude=/backup.tgz --exclude=/mnt --exclude=/sys --exclude=/media /

恢復 tar xvpfz backup.tgz -C /

恢復命令結束時,你的工作還沒完成,別忘了重新創建那些在備份時被排除在外的目錄:
# mkdir proc
# mkdir lost+found
# mkdir mnt
# mkdir sys

# mkdir media
等等

http://www.linuxidc.com/Linux/2014-01/94973.htm

http://www.cnblogs.com/samael/articles/2033568.html

11.安裝eclipse    先安裝JDK

cd /opt/ && sudo tar -zxvf ~/下載/eclipse-*.tar.gz

gksudo gedit /usr/share/applications/eclipse.desktop

2、粘貼並保存如下內容

[Desktop Entry]
Name=Eclipse 4
Type=Application
Exec=/opt/eclipse/eclipse
Terminal=false
Icon=/opt/eclipse/icon.xpm
Comment=Integrated Development Environment
NoDisplay=false
Categories=Development;IDE;
Name[en]=Eclipse

http://www.linuxidc.com/Linux/2014-08/105090.htm

12.更改文件所有者

chown 你的用戶名:用戶組 htdocs   或者     chown 你的用戶名 htdocs
兩句都可以,第一句同時改變了文件所屬的用戶組。

13.共享wlan0到eth0

共享internet連接,在設備上啓用nat即可:
echo 1 > /proc/sys/net/ipv4/ip_forward   //啓用ipv4數據包轉發
或者 /etc/sysctl.conf文件中   "# net.ipv4.ip_forward = 0"的這一行,移除#號(即取消註釋)
iptables -t nat -I POSTROUTING -o wlan0 -j MASQUERADE  //在wlan0接口上啓用IP僞裝(源地址NAT)
然後將連接到設備的網關指向設備的eth0即可。 重啓失效,添加到默認啓動文件/etc/rc.local
iptables forward功能配置:     iptables –t nat –L –n   查看nat表
http://blog.163.com/leekwen@126/blog/static/33166229200981954962/
http://linux.chinaunix.net/techdoc/net/2009/02/11/1061725.shtml
PREROUTING SNAT  源地址轉換          PORTROUTING SNAT  目的地址轉換
14. 連接wifi
iwlist wlan0 scanning | grep ESSID
sudo iw dev wlan0 connect [網絡 SSID] key 0:[WEP 密鑰]
15.防火牆  ufw enable    iptables -A -P
http://blog.csdn.net/guochunyang/article/details/49865441
http://my.oschina.net/biezhi/blog/485731
 iptables-save >/etc/sysconfig/iptables 保存    iptables-restore >/etc/sysconfig/iptables  恢復,載入
16.


發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章